Full course description

Description

This webinar addresses the growing mental health challenges among youth, emphasizing the impact of social media, the pandemic, and vaping on their well-being. It explores key risk factors like bullying and family issues, as well as protective factors such as supportive environments, in shaping mental health outcomes. The session highlights the importance of open communication between parents, educators, and youth to foster trust and emotional security, alongside the need for early intervention to prevent more serious issues. The discussion also covers the intersection of vaping and mental health, detailing how emotional stressors can lead youth to engage in vaping behaviors, which in turn can worsen anxiety and depression. Featuring insights from federal scientific thought leaders, the webinar offers actionable strategies to address the youth mental health crisis, focusing on a holistic approach that integrates emotional and physical health. Attendees, including school health staff and educators, will gain the knowledge and tools to support youth in navigating these complex challenges, with a roadmap for improving mental health outcomes and building resilience through coping strategies.
